After a day of exploring Boston, unwind at one of the three on-site restaurants at the Boston Omni Parker House Hotel. Start your day on a delicious note with a visit to School Street Coffeehouse, a family-friendly spot perfect for a casual breakfast. For a more upscale dining experience, head over to The Last Hurrah, offering modern ambiance and scrumptious American cuisine. And for a taste of classic Boston, Parker's Restaurant exudes a cozy, family-friendly atmosphere where you can savor the flavors of traditional American dishes.

Thank Goodness for the business center. We had to print our tickets and no one at the hotel could print due to services being down. The business center printers worked! We never ate at Parkers because it was only open for breakfast and lunch and we would leave early on our travel adventures and return late and they were closed. We did et at The Last Hurrah and the food was good but WAY overpriced! 14,00 for a tiny basket of pretzel bits and a thimble of cheese was ridiculous but it was good and we ordered it twice. LOL The hotel location is PERFECT! Bean Town Pub next door to drink a cold Samuel Adams while looking across the street at the cold and dead Samuel Adams grave, Close to Fanueil Hall and Quincy Market, Walgreens down the street, Boston Commons across the street... Really a great location. We were in a deluxe room with two double beds and it was tight for two of us and suit cases. The rooms are small as is the bath but really you are not there to sit in the room so we did not care. They room was nice and comfortable and the linens were comfy. I just wanted a bigger television. Shower pressure was the best I have ever had at a hotel and plenty of hot water. We were on the 12th floor and had a lovely view over the church next door and the bridge in the distance. The staff was excellent and the doormen, security and servers/bartenders were all friendly and helpful.

The staff went above and beyond to make us feel comfortable and welcome. The location is ideal, as it’s right on the Freedom Trail. The hotel itself is cozy, beautifully decorated, and has everything you need for a great stay (including free bottled waters, which are a must in summer)! Not only is the hotel close to the major attractions, but it’s a piece of history itself - we were told a number of famous writers had stayed there and that JFK proposed to Jackie at their restaurant! Boston is an incredible city rich in history, and staying at the Boston Omni Parker truly elevated our experience.
